Tumbes, Peru

Tumbes is one of 26 primary administrative regions in Peru with a population of approximately 191,713 people.

The regional headquarters of Tumbes (Tumbes) is located in the regional capital Tumbes (Tumbes) with a population of 96,946 people.

The distance as the crow flies from Tumbes's regional capital Tumbes to Peru's capital Lima (Lima) is approximately 1,012 km (629 mi).
